Understanding the Affiliate Marketing Funnel Model

Affiliate funnels are not fundamentally different from traditional marketing funnels. They guide prospects through stages:

  • Awareness: Introducing the audience to a problem or opportunity
  • Interest: Capturing attention and encouraging them to seek more information
  • Consideration: Providing in-depth content and nurturing leads to build trust
  • Decision: Presenting affiliate offers with a strong call to action
  • Post-Sale Nurturing: Encouraging repeat purchases or upsells through additional affiliate offers

Why Traditional Direct Linking Is Failing

Direct linking to affiliate products worked well in the early days of affiliate marketing, but with increasing competition and consumer skepticism, it's no longer sufficient. Without warming up your audience and building trust, your click-to-sale conversion rates will suffer.

Affiliate funnels address this by providing value at each step, positioning you as a helpful guide rather than just another salesperson.

Step-by-Step: Building Evergreen Affiliate Funnels

Step 1: Creating Awareness through Valuable Content

Start by producing high-quality content that targets problems your ideal customers are facing. Examples include:

  • SEO-optimized blog posts answering common questions
  • YouTube videos showing how to solve specific challenges
  • Podcast episodes interviewing experts or sharing personal experiences

The goal is to attract organic or paid traffic into your ecosystem without pushing an offer immediately.

Step 2: Capturing Leads with Irresistible Offers

Instead of sending visitors directly to affiliate links, create lead magnets that provide immediate value:

  • Free checklists or cheat sheets
  • Video tutorials or mini-courses
  • Webinars or live Q&A sessions

Use landing pages to capture emails, allowing you to follow up and nurture relationships over time.

Step 3: Nurturing Leads through Email Sequences

Once you have captured leads, nurture them with automated email sequences that:

  • Educate on the problem and solutions
  • Share personal stories and case studies
  • Provide product recommendations with affiliate links

A well-crafted sequence can span days or weeks, moving prospects naturally toward conversion.

Step 4: Presenting Affiliate Offers Authentically

When presenting offers, focus on how the product solves their pain points rather than its features. Use scarcity ethically by highlighting limited-time discounts or bonuses you provide.

Step 5: Post-Purchase Nurturing and Upselling

The journey doesn't end with the sale. Continue nurturing buyers by offering:

  • Upsells or related products
  • Exclusive content or communities
  • Advanced training with affiliate upsell opportunities

Case Study: Affiliate Funnel that Generated Sales for Years

A digital marketing blogger created an evergreen funnel targeting entrepreneurs looking for email marketing tools. They produced an in-depth blog post comparing tools, offered a free checklist via a lead magnet, and nurtured leads through an automated 7-day email sequence sharing personal stories, tips, and recommending their favorite tool through an affiliate link.

Even after two years, this funnel continued generating commissions with minimal maintenance, demonstrating the power of evergreen affiliate funnels when built strategically.
